Enterprise scale SAP Test Data Management without the complexity
SAP Test Data Management with Dynamic Data Replicator (DDR) for enterprise scale environments
SAP Test Data Management is no longer a one off project activity. DDR is a SAP native ABAP add on designed for continuous, operational Test Data Management across Development, QA, UAT and Training systems. It enables fast refresh cycles, secure data handling, and repeatable execution without additional infrastructure.
Why continuous Test Data Management matters
SAP Test Data Management is no longer an occasional activity triggered by a major release. In enterprise landscapes, it becomes a continuous operational need. Teams require reliable and secure test environments that can be refreshed quickly and consistently.
Without an operational approach, refresh cycles often become slow, disruptive, and risky. Testing is delayed, delivery slips, and sensitive data exposure increases.
For background reading, see the SAP S/4HANA documentation and the UK Information Commissioner’s Office guidance on data protection.
What is Dynamic Data Replicator
Dynamic Data Replicator (DDR) is a SAP native ABAP add on built for continuous, enterprise scale Test Data Management. It runs within SAP and enables controlled refresh and copy processes across non production systems.
Designed for SAP teams
- Development, QA, UAT, Training
- Repeatable processes with governance
- Built for day to day operations
Designed for SAP landscapes
- ECC and S 4HANA ready
- No additional infrastructure
- Clean Core aligned approach
Core capabilities
DDR provides a set of capabilities that focus on speed, control, and security. The goal is to deliver realistic test environments quickly, without copying unnecessary data or exposing sensitive information.
Refresh and copy
- Client refresh and selective copy
- Time slice refresh for controlled history
- Delta refresh for faster iterations
Security and compliance
- GDPR compliant masking and scrambling
- Controlled execution with auditability
- Secure handling of sensitive fields
Performance and availability
- Parallel processing
- Near zero downtime execution patterns
- Reduced disruption to business teams
Trust and repeatability
- Validation and reconciliation
- Snapshot and rollback confidence
- One click repeatable execution
Strengths and why it is different
DDR is delivered as a single application with a single licence. This simplifies procurement, support, governance, and operational ownership.
- Operational TDM: designed for continuous use, not one time projects.
- Landscape ready: supports ECC and S 4HANA, designed for real SAP environments.
- Clean Core aligned: built for long term maintainability with SAP friendly design.
- No additional infrastructure: reduces complexity, cost, and risk.
Typical use case
Ongoing test system management across the SAP landscape. Organisations use DDR to keep Development, QA, UAT and Training systems current, secure, and consistent so delivery teams can work without delays.
Getting started
A practical way to begin is to target the refresh stream that creates the most disruption today, then expand across the landscape once governance and repeatability are proven.
- Define the systems and clients in scope
- Choose the refresh strategy: full, selective, time slice, or delta
- Apply masking and scrambling rules for compliance
- Enable validation and reconciliation for confidence
- Operationalise with one click repeatable runs and logging